黑狐家游戏

数据库存储过程创建流程详解及流程图展示,数据库创建存储过程流程图怎么画

欧气 0 0

本文目录导读:

  1. 数据库存储过程创建流程
  2. 流程图展示

随着数据库技术的不断发展,存储过程已成为数据库中不可或缺的一部分,存储过程可以将一系列的SQL语句封装在一起,以提高数据库操作的效率,简化应用程序的开发,本文将详细介绍数据库存储过程的创建流程,并提供相应的流程图,以便读者更好地理解。

数据库存储过程创建流程

1、确定存储过程名称和参数

在创建存储过程之前,首先需要确定存储过程的名称和所需参数,存储过程名称应具有描述性,便于后续调用,参数用于传递数据,包括输入参数、输出参数和输入输出参数。

数据库存储过程创建流程详解及流程图展示,数据库创建存储过程流程图怎么画

图片来源于网络,如有侵权联系删除

2、设计存储过程逻辑

根据业务需求,设计存储过程的逻辑,逻辑包括以下内容:

(1)数据验证:对输入参数进行验证,确保其符合要求。

(2)数据操作:执行SQL语句,实现数据插入、更新、删除等操作。

(3)结果处理:根据业务需求,对操作结果进行处理,如返回操作成功或失败信息。

3、编写存储过程代码

数据库存储过程创建流程详解及流程图展示,数据库创建存储过程流程图怎么画

图片来源于网络,如有侵权联系删除

根据设计逻辑,使用SQL语言编写存储过程代码,以下是一个简单的存储过程示例:

CREATE PROCEDURE sp_GetUserInfo
    @UserID INT
AS
BEGIN
    SELECT * FROM Users WHERE UserID = @UserID;
END

4、测试存储过程

在创建存储过程后,进行测试以确保其功能正常,测试方法包括:

(1)手动调用存储过程,验证返回结果是否符合预期。

(2)编写测试脚本,模拟实际业务场景,验证存储过程性能。

5、调用存储过程

数据库存储过程创建流程详解及流程图展示,数据库创建存储过程流程图怎么画

图片来源于网络,如有侵权联系删除

在应用程序中,通过调用存储过程来执行数据库操作,以下是一个调用存储过程的示例:

EXEC sp_GetUserInfo @UserID = 1;

流程图展示

以下为数据库存储过程创建流程的流程图:

+------------------+       +------------------+       +------------------+
| 确定存储过程名称 | ----> | 设计存储过程逻辑 | ----> | 编写存储过程代码 |
+------------------+       +------------------+       +------------------+
       ^                       |                       |
       |                       |                       |
       +----------------------+                       |
                                                         |
                                                         V
                                                   +------------------+
                                                   | 测试存储过程     |
                                                   +------------------+
                                                         |
                                                         V
                                                   +------------------+
                                                   | 调用存储过程     |
                                                   +------------------+

本文详细介绍了数据库存储过程的创建流程,并提供了相应的流程图,通过学习本文,读者可以更好地理解存储过程的创建过程,为实际应用提供参考,在实际开发过程中,请根据业务需求灵活运用存储过程,以提高数据库操作效率和应用程序性能。

标签: #数据库创建存储过程流程图

黑狐家游戏
  • 评论列表

留言评论